We Is Better than Me

JOHN MAXWELL
About this episode

John Maxwell says that 1 is too small of a number to achieve greatness, and he’s absolutely right. If you want to achieve anything big, you need others. That’s where the power of teams lies. This week we’re talking about how we is better than me.

In this lesson, John Maxwell shares 6 reasons why team effort is superior to individual effort. Some of these may seem obvious to you, but others may be newer and more challenging. That’s why, after John’s lesson, Mark Cole and Becky Bursell will help you navigate John’s lesson and how to apply it to your own leadership.
